AI Gharana
Freestyle AI research for students
"Gharana" means a school of thought, a tradition of learning passed down through practice. AI Gharana is exactly that: a student run AI research lab with no rigid curriculum in L. J. University. Students pick problems they're curious about, form small teams, and research freely. The idea is simple, give smart people space and they'll surprise you.
